摘  要:BACKGROUND Diabetic encephalopathy(DE)is a common and serious complication of diabetes that can cause death in many patients and significantly affects the lives of individuals and society.Multiple studies investigating the pathogenesis of DE have been reported.However,few studies have focused on scientometric analysis of DE.AIM To analyze literature on DE using scientometrics to provide a comprehensive picture of research directions and progress in this field.METHODS We reviewed studies on DE or cognitive impairment published between 2004 and 2023.The latter were used to identify the most frequent keywords in the keyword analysis and explore the hotspots and trends of DE.RESULTS Scientometric analysis revealed 1308 research papers on DE,a number that increased annually over the past 20 years,and that the primary topics explored were domain distribution,knowledge structure,evolution,and emergence of research topics related to DE.The inducing factors,comorbidities,pathogenesis,treatment,and animal models of DE help clarify its occurrence,development,and treatment.An increasing number of studies on DE may be a result of the recent increase in patients with diabetes,unhealthy lifestyles,and unhealthy eating habits,which have aggravated the incidence of this disease.CONCLUSION We identified the main inducing factors and comorbidities of DE,though other complex factors undoubtedly increase social and economic burdens.These findings provide vital references for future studies.
